Cardiovascular Pathology and Vascular Biology

The Cardiovascular Pathology and Vascular Biology session provides a comprehensive overview of both structural and molecular abnormalities affecting the heart and vascular system. It will cover a range of conditions, including atherosclerosis, myocarditis, vasculitis, cardiomyopathies, and congenital heart defects. Emphasis will be placed on updated diagnostic criteria and classification systems, along with the interpretation of critical autopsy findings in cases such as myocardial infarction and sudden cardiac death. The session will also explore advances in molecular pathology, with a focus on vascular injury, thrombosis mechanisms, and endothelial dysfunction. Attendees will gain insights into the application of emerging biomarkers and diagnostic assays that enhance clinical decision-making. Multidisciplinary case discussions will integrate histopathology with advanced imaging, highlighting the importance of collaborative approaches. Special attention will be given to immune-mediated and inflammatory vascular diseases, promoting dialogue across pathology, cardiology, and vascular biology. This session is designed to equip professionals with the latest tools, perspectives, and translational knowledge in cardiovascular diagnostics.
